Setting Apart and Designating As Sudlon National Park For Park Purposes For the Benefit and Enjoyment of the People of the Philippines the Parcel of Public Domain Situated in the Municipality of Cebu, Province of Cebu, Island of Cebu
Proclamation No. 56
April 11, 1936
Case Overview and Summary
Proclamation Establishing Sudlon National Park- Designates a 696-hectare parcel of public domain in Cebu, Cebu as the "Sudlon National Park" for park purposes and enjoyment of the people of the Philippines. (Section 1)
- Provides detailed land boundaries and coordinates marking the park area. (Section 1)
- Places the park under the administration of the Bureau of Forestry, subject to the executive control of the Secretary of Agriculture and Commerce. (Section 1)
- Allows the Secretary of Agriculture and Commerce, upon recommendation of the Director of Forestry, to declare portions of the park open for mining entry when public interests require and it will not be detrimental to government projects, with the condition: "When public interests so require, and when it will not be detrimental to any project being undertaken by the Government, the Secretary of Agriculture and Commerce, upon the recommendation of the Director of Forestry, may declare any portion or portions of this park as subject to mining entry." (Section 2)

MALACAÑANG PALACEManila
Proclamation No. 56
SETTING APART AND DESIGNATING AS SUDLON NATIONAL PARK FOR PARK PURPOSES FOR THE BENEFIT AND ENJOYMENT OF THE PEOPLE OF THE PHILIPPINES THE PARCEL OF PUBLIC DOMAIN SITUATED IN THE MUNICIPALITY OF CEBU, PROVINCE OF CEBU, ISLAND OF CEBU
Upon the recommendation of the Secretary of Agriculture an Commerce and pursuant to the provisions of section one of Act Numbered Thirty-nine hundred and fifteen, entitled "An Act providing for the establishment of national parks, declaring such parks as game refuges and for other purposes," I, Manuel L.
